Lenovo ThinkPad Edge E480 - the best budget laptop
Let's start with a fairly powerful Lenovo laptop, which is distinguished by a very rich selection of modifications . Also, very good physical parameters and characteristics. The dimensions of the laptop are - 329.3x242x21.9 mm, weight - 1.75 kg, and the screen is 14 inches.

The processor can be Core i3, i5 or i7 with 2 or 4 cores with a frequency of 1600 to 2200 GHz. The amount of RAM is from 4 to 8 GB and it is possible to install up to 32 GB of memory. The SSD capacity is from 256 GB. In addition, the video card can be integrated UHD Graphics 620 or discrete AMD Radeon Rx 550 with 2 GB of memory.
To connect external devices, there are three USB 3.1 ports, one USB 2.0 port and an HDMI video interface. A fingerprint scanner is used for strict authentication. The manufacturer claims a battery life of 13 hours, but this figure is higher. The actual battery capacity is 45 Wh.
Advantages:
- Weighs less than 2 kg;
- Has a wide range of modifications;
- There is a fingerprint scanner;
- Possibility of renewal;
- High-quality equipment;
- Keyboard lighting.
Negative:
- Insufficient screen brightness level.
HP ProBook 440 G5
The second place in our rating is taken by a notebook from the famous American company HP , which is designed for study. In terms of technical parameters, performance and available modifications, this model is identical to the previous one, but weighs a little more and has a higher cost. The dimensions of the laptop are 336x238x20 mm, weight - 1.63 kg., and the screen size is 14 inches. The matrix is IPS, the resolution of which is 1366x768 or 1920x1080.

RAM is available in 4 or 8 GB. In addition to two USB ports of different generations, there is also a VGA-out (D-Sub), DisplayPort and HDMI-video interface. Additionally, there is a fingerprint scanner, and the total battery capacity is 48 Wh.
Advantages:
- Optimal performance;
- Sufficient screen brightness;
- Attractive appearance;
- Light weight.
DELL INSPIRON 5770
In third place in the ranking of the best laptops is the DELL laptop, which is a fairly bright model, which is notable, first of all, for its impressive screen size, which is why it is recommended for students.

The model is especially useful for students studying graphics-related specialties, such as design, engineering, video editing, etc. The dimensions of the notebook are 415.4 × 279.2 × 25 mm, and the screen diagonal is 17.3.
Depending on the screen size, its weight is 2.79 kg. The standard RAM capacity is 4 GB or 8 GB, and the expansion limit is 16 GB. Unlike the previous two models, this notebook is equipped with a DVD-RW drive.
Advantages:
- Wide range of configurations;
- Beautiful design;
- Large screen;
- The presence of a DVD drive, which can be replaced with an SSD.
